当前位置:首页 > 技术文章 > 正文内容

Nginx服务器其它高级功能介绍(nginx服务主要功能)

arlanguage3个月前 (01-31)技术文章24

Nginx服务器对于普通的网站也适用,对于大流量,高并发的网站也适用,下面介绍一下Nginx服务器的一些高级使用场景。

Nginx 服务器常用功能介绍如下:

1、配置虚拟站点

2、配置反向代理

3、配置SSL证书

Nginx 服务器高级功能:

1、缓存和静态文件服务:这是用来提高网站的访问速度和性能的,对于网站流程很大,并发量大时,才会用到。

2、安全性和防护:比如限制访问、防止恶意请求和 DDoS 攻击,对于运营成功的网站,得加强这方向的操作,若是用的是阿里云服务器,可以直接购买阿里去的WAF,这样比较方便,不用自己去操作这些了。

3、负载均衡:分发到多个后端服务器,提高系统的性能和可扩展性,对于网站流程大的才用到,若是阿里云服务器,那么可以直接用阿里云的CLB/ALB/NLB,再加上一个弹性伸缩,用起来还是很方便的,就不用自己从头到尾的搞了,而且很经济。

4、扩展和定制

5、性能优化

6、日志和监控

7、高可用性和故障转移

注:本介绍,可以当作是Nginx服务器的大纲,指导使用,真遇到大流量,高并发时,有应对策略,做到手中有粮不慌,并不是每个技术都需要深究的,有了大纲,等真的遇到了,再去研究也不迟的,这样效率更高,更真实。若是写得不全的,希望大家在评论区补充上,谢谢了!

扫描二维码推送至手机访问。

版权声明:本文由AR编程网发布,如需转载请注明出处。

本文链接:http://www.arlanguage.com/post/1366.html

分享给朋友:

“Nginx服务器其它高级功能介绍(nginx服务主要功能)” 的相关文章

Nginx日志切割方法(包含docker容器中nginx日志的切割)

logrotate软件简介logrotate 是一个 Bash 的 SHELL 脚本,可对日志文件进行切分,并将切分后的日志放在统一目录。logrotate 要求 GNU bash、GNU gzip 和 GNU date。logrotate 实用程序旨在简化在生成大量日志文件的系统上对日志文件的管理...

三年前端还不会配置Nginx?刷完这篇就够了

一口气看完,比自学强十倍!什么是NginxNginx是一个开源的高性能HTTP和反向代理服务器。它可以用于处理静态资源、负载均衡、反向代理和缓存等任务。Nginx被广泛用于构建高可用性、高性能的Web应用程序和网站。它具有低内存消耗、高并发能力和良好的稳定性,因此在互联网领域非常受欢迎。为什么使用N...

nginx 多域名配置 nginx多站点配置示例

Nginx 可以配置多个域名,以便根据不同的域名来处理不同的请求。下面是一个配置多个域名的例子:server { listen 80; server_name example1.com; location / { root /var/www/example1...

Windows下配置Nginx开机自启动

如何安装、配置网站就不说了,文章主要讲讲windows中如何让nginx开机自启动1.windows中配置nginx开机启动需要借助Windows Service Wrapper工具。可以通过地址http://repo.jenkins-ci.org/releases/com/sun/winsw/wi...

压测nginx出现的问题分析

压测nginx出现no live upstreams while connecting to upstream的问题分析基础环境版本信息Centos 7.1nginx version: openresty/1.13.6.2nginx配置信息stream {   ...

nginx检查提示“unknown directive "stream" in /etc/*/nginx.conf”

yum安装nginx检查时提示“unknown directive "stream" in /etc/nginx/nginx.conf”yum安装nginx,在配置反代时,出现错误:nginx -tnginx: [emerg] unknown directive "strea...